Jr. Canadiens win 2008 OHL Cup
The final of the 2008 OHL Showcase Tournament for the OHL Cup featuredra rematch of the Greater Toronto Hockey League Championship Series asrthe Toronto Marlboros took on the Toronto Jr. Canadiens. The Marlborosrwere the first ones to light the lamp as Michael Hawkrigg found therback of the net off of a shot from just above the face-off dot 5:03rinto the contest.

rThe Jr. Candiens offense responded with two goals of their own beforerthe end of the first frame. The first from Tyler Toffoli and a powerrplay marker from Cody McNaughton on a set up from Toffoli. The firstrperiod came to a close with the Jr. Canadiens leading 2-1.

rLess than a minute into the second period John McFarland picked the toprcorner from the top of the slot to beat Jon-Paul Anderson and extendrthe Jr. Canadiens’ lead to 3-1. The Marlies reduced the lead to arsingle goal when Freddie Hamilton capped off a solid individual effortrby beating Canadiens’ goalie Spencer Sommerville with a backhand shotrthat found the top corner of the net. The score remained 3-2 in favourrof the Jr. Canadiens entering the third period.

rChasen Balisy restored the Jr. Canadiens two goal lead 3:19 into therperiod off of a feed from Devante Smith-Pelly. Tournament MVP,rMcFarland iced the game for the Jr. Canadiens with his second goal ofrthe game with just over a minute remaining in the contest.

rToffoli was named player of the game for the Jr. Canadiens with a goalrand three assists. Marlboros’ goaltender, Anderson turned in a solidrperformance to earn his team’s player of the game. McFarland was namedrthe tournament MVP after scoring eight goals and adding seven assistsrfor 15 points in seven games.
